I want to change the heads on my 68 302. I'll be running an Edelbrock performer intake with an Edelbrock 625 CFM carburetor. It makes sense to put Edelbrock Performer heads on the car but they're pretty costly. I've seen gt 40 heads on sale; will they work on my application?

gt-40p heads will work but there are some down falls. You'll need special headers because the spark plugs go out of the head straight instead of angled. You'll lose some compression because your stock heads are most likely 55-58cc and the new Gt-40p heads are 64cc. By the time your done your already spent more money then just getting the edelbrock heads.
